## Deployment

Liftwright, the elevator-dispatch simulator, ships as a single container plus a results store. Deploy the store first, run the schema migration, then roll the simulator nodes one at a time. Smoke-test by running the ten-car scenario and confirming dispatch latency stays under the published budget. Once the nodes report healthy, apply the runtime configuration, which for this release is as follows.

settings of tagef-bawif:
DRUIX_HOST=druix.zemvarlabs.internal
DRUIX_PORT=8000

## Sensor drift: what to do at 3am

If the GrowLoop controller starts reporting humidity swings that don't match the backup probes in the Fernwick greenhouse, it's almost always sensor drift, not an actual climate event. Don't panic and don't touch the vents manually. First, restart the calibration daemon and give it ten minutes to re-baseline. If readings still disagree by more than 5%, flip the controller into safe mode. The safe-mode thresholds it will use are these.

config for yahap-bajof:
[istix]
host = istix.qorvelsys.internal
user = istix_svc
database = istix_prod

During today's audit we found that the staging instance of the Validex plugin system loads three validator plugins that production does not, and the schema-strictness flag differs between the two environments. This likely explains the divergent rejection rates reported by the Harrowfield ingest team last week. Please do not hand-edit either environment; drift should be reconciled through the Ossuary deploy pipeline only. For reference, the values production is currently running with are listed here.

config for kawif-hahig:
zorix:
  log_level: error
  metrics_host: metrics.zorix.lumiclabs.internal
  pool_size: 16